My Phone Randomly Restarting and Battery Issues – Here's What Happened and How I’m Getting It Fixed

Recently, my phone started randomly restarting and wouldn’t stay powered on unless it was connected to a charger. I knew something was wrong with the battery, so I contacted Apple Support for help. Through chat, an advisor ran a diagnostic test and shared the following:


Apple Support Feedback:

"Upon checking the diagnostic report, I see that your battery has degraded to 59% with 1,280 charging cycles. Apple recommends replacing the battery when it drops below 80%, and in this case, your battery has exceeded its expected lifespan. Replacing it would restore full capacity."


This was really helpful, but I also learned something that I think everyone should be aware of:


  • If you have AppleCare+, it covers battery replacements for certain Apple products when the battery holds less than 80% of its original capacity. So, if your phone’s battery is struggling, this might be a good option for you.
  • However, if your insurance is through your carrier, like mine is, you should check if they offer unlimited battery replacements. For example, I have AT&T’s Protection Advantage Insurance and Protection Advantage Support Services as part of my phone plan, and it includes unlimited battery replacements. This was a game changer for me!
  • After chatting with Apple Support, I set an appointment with my local AT&T store to have a ProTech test my battery in person to confirm if it qualifies for a replacement under my insurance. According to Apple’s diagnostic, it should be eligible, but the ProTech needs to verify this as part of the process.


I’ll update everyone once I go through the appointment to let you know how it all turns out!


Pro Tip: If you’re experiencing similar issues and don’t know where to start, I recommend going straight to Apple Chat Support. Have them run a diagnostic test on your device. It’s quick and easy, and they’ll tell you exactly what’s wrong with your phone.

UPDATE: I went to my appointment, but they informed me that I would need to file a claim through Asurion instead, so setting an appointment with AT&T turned out to be unproductive. I had to go all the way back home and file the claim online because the automated system kept rejecting my phone number. You can file a claim at this website: Asurion Claims for AT&T.


After submitting the claim with all the details, you have two options: either have a technician come to you or take it to a local store. Given that this was the third day dealing with battery issues, I chose to visit a nearby Ubreakifix store to expedite the process. However, when I got there, they were short-staffed, and I was told that the phone wouldn’t be ready until 6 pm—which was frustrating since I dropped it off around 11 am.


Hopefully, I’ll get my phone back soon, and I’ll update you all with how it turns out!
